Le 31/07/2020 à 10:32, Girish Vasmatkar a écrit :
Greetings!

I have created a PR to add a REST component -
https://github.com/apache/ofbiz-plugins/pull/35 . Please take a look
and let me know what you think and let me know if you face any issues. I
intend to merge it in a week from now.

With the PR (https://github.com/apache/ofbiz-framework/pull/214) to add
"action" attribute to the service definition now merged, this above
component should be able to expose exportable (export=true) and
actionable(action=GET|POST) services via REST.

Once the changes for nested attributes (OFBIZ-11902
<https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/OFBIZ-11902>) are done, I will also
be making corresponding changes in the GraphQL plugin to account for nested
attributes. OFBIZ-11902
<https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/OFBIZ-11902> will
help in defining complex GraphQL mutations.

I am parallelly also working on designing an XML DSL for REST that should
allow tying up REST resources with OFBiz services.

On Thu, Jul 9, 2020 at 6:27 PM Shi Jinghai <huaru...@hotmail.com> wrote:

Hi Girish,

Yes, you got it.

Web browser will popup a login dialog when response code is 401:
setResponseHeader("WWW-Authenticate", "Bearer realm=\"authentication
required\"");

The popup is skipped and then react/vue/angular can handle the response:
setResponseHeader("WWW-Authenticate", "OFBiz realm=\"authentication
required\"");

Hi Shi

Thanks for taking a look at it. I have a question on "WWW-Authenticate"
header so please clarify and I can make appropriate changes accordingly -

All I am finding is that to prevent the pop-up, either return 403 (which I
do not want to do) or not include "WWW-Authenticate" header at all (not
inclined to do this as well because then we would be violating the spec).
Do you mean to NOT start the value of the header with "Bearer" ?
so instead of below

*WWW-Authenticate: Bearer realm="Access to OFBiz", charset="UTF-8"*

should we change it to

*WWW-Authenticate: xBearer realm="Access to OFBiz", charset="UTF-8"*

I did not test it, but I can just change it like this without testing if
you can please confirm it will prevent the browser dialog.
